O.S. No.424/2018

Case between Reshma S S vs Rekha S S regarding realization of money

Court
THE COURT OF THE THIRD ADDL. MUNSIFF & RENT CONTROLLER
Judge
Smt. REEJA R. NAIR.
Order Date
2024-12-21
Duration
approximately-6 years 11 months

Judgement document from eCourt website

Open judgment PDF (eCourt)
Find Similar Cases

Case Summary

The plaintiff Reshma and the defendant Rekha are siblings involved in a dispute over compensation related to property transfer. The plaintiff claims the defendant failed to pay Rs.8,00,000 after a settlement agreement.

Judgment Outcome

Plaintiff Won
Interim Order
The suit was decreed in favor of the plaintiff, ordering the defendant to pay Rs.8,00,000 with interest. The court found merit in the plaintiff's claim regarding the dishonored cheque.
Judgment Favored
Plaintiff
Relief Granted
Defendant to pay Rs.8,00,000 with interest @ 6% per annum.
Case Type
Civil Suit
Final Judgment
No
Why Plaintiff Won:
The plaintiff successfully proved her case regarding the dishonored cheque intended as compensation.

Judgment Evidence:

In the result, suit is decreed with costs directing the defendant to pay an amount of Rs.8,00,000(Rupees Eight Lakhs only) to the plaintiff with interest @ 6% per annum from the date of suit till the date of its realization.
